Webb27 sep. 2024 · From SharePoint 2013 and in Online, a new default permission level is given to the Members group i.e. Edit. In addition to the capabilities given by the Contribute permission level, Edit also gives users additional abilities to edit and delete existing lists, plus create new lists. If you go to Site Settings -> Site Permissions -> Permission Levels, this will take you to the page with the settings for the different permission levels. Assuming they come up in the same order, Contribute is the 4th item down and has a description "Can view, add, update, and delete list items and documents.". Edit is the 3rd …
